Internal Legal Counsel
An exciting opportunity for an experienced Internal Legal Counsel to join a cutting-edge technology company developing highly innovative hardware and AI software products.
As the business continues to scale, they are looking for a commercially minded Legal Counsel to establish and develop their in-house legal capability, becoming a trusted advisor to senior leadership across a broad range of strategic business matters.
This is a rare opportunity to join an ambitious technology business where legal is viewed as a strategic business function, helping to shape commercial decisions, manage risk, and support the company's continued growth. Working at the intersection of artificial intelligence, software, and advanced hardware, you will play a key role in supporting the company's next phase of growth.
Location: North Uttlesford / Greater Cambridge Area (5 days onsite)
Salary: Competitive + benefits package
Requirements for Internal Legal Counsel:
- Qualified Solicitor in England & Wales (or equivalent recognised jurisdiction)
- Significant post-qualification experience gained in-house and/or within a leading commercial law firm
- Strong experience drafting, reviewing, and negotiating complex commercial agreements
- Excellent knowledge of technology law, intellectual property, software licensing, and data protection legislation
- Strong commercial awareness with the ability to provide pragmatic, business-focused legal advice
-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ills
- Applicants must be fully eligible to work in the UK without restriction, time limit, or sponsorship
Desirable:
- Experience within an AI, software, SaaS, or high-growth technology company
- Knowledge of AI governance, emerging AI regulation, or responsible AI frameworks
- Experience implementing legal operations, contract management systems, or compliance programmes
Responsibilities for Internal Legal Counsel:
- Provide commercially focused legal advice across a broad range of business activities
- Draft, review, negotiate, and manage commercial agreements including customer, supplier, partnership, licensing, SaaS, and confidentiality agreements
- Advise on legal matters relating to AI technologies, software licensing, intellectual property, data protection, privacy, and emerging regulatory frameworks
- Support corporate governance, compliance, and risk management initiatives across the business
- Monitor developments in UK and international legislation affecting AI and technology businesses, providing practical guidance to stakeholders
- Work closely with senior leadership to support strategic business decisions and manage legal risk
- Manage relationships with external legal advisers where specialist expertise is required
- Help shape and develop the company's internal legal function as the business continues to grow
